The Hepatojugular Reflex: Reasons , Detection , and Meaning
The hepatic response is a observed sign that indicates the vascular system's response to manage increased systemic load . This is often assessed by noting the individual's neck conduits while applying direct compression to the abdomen region. A positive jugular reflex – shown by a rise in jugular central pressure – implies a problem in the right venous return. Possible origins involve cardiac dysfunction, fixed pericarditis, caudal vena cava obstruction , and abdominal fullness . Diagnosis is based on physical assessment and may be confirmed by echocardiography to identify underlying conditions . The significance of a positive hepatojugular response lies in its potential to inform further investigation and treatment of significant cardiovascular conditions .

Liver-Biliary Cancer Latest Progress in Therapy
Significant advancements are being made in the therapy of cancers of the bile ducts and liver. Immunotherapy , particularly those targeting PD-1 , are now utilized for certain patients with metastatic h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). Furthermore, precision medicine approaches focusing on specific alterations are showing efficacy in clinical trials . Minimally invasive surgical approaches are enhancing outcomes for operable tumors, and liver-directed therapies like radioembolization are demonstrating benefit for those with unresectable . Finally, active research is investigating innovative approaches and screening strategies to enhance survival rates and patient outcomes.
